Abstract

The invention discloses a floor structure for a raw bamboo structural system. The floor structure for the raw bamboo structural system comprises a raw bamboo floor beam, wherein the whole raw bamboo floor beam is formed by arranging and fixing raw bamboos side by side, the raw bamboo floor beam is covered with a layer of thermal insulation materials, and the thermal insulation materials are covered with a layer of anti-crack mortar. The floor structure for the raw bamboo structural system is simple, operation is convenient, the thermal insulation property of a floor is improved, seasonal limitation or regional limitation caused by poor thermal insulation property of a floor is reduced, the impervious performance is high, the overall tensile property of the floor is improved due to the fact that the overall tenacity of the raw bamboos is high, and the overall anti-seismic effect is not influenced.

Embodiment 1
Referring to Fig. 1-2, for a floor slab structure for former bamboo structure system, it comprises former bamboo tower plate-girder 1, and this former bamboo tower plate-girder 1 entirety is arranged side by side fixing and is formed by former bamboo, on described former bamboo tower plate-girder 1, be coated with one layer of heat preservation material 2, on described heat insulating material 2, be coated with one deck anticracking grout 3; Wherein, described former bamboo preferably to adopt diameter be the former bamboo one-tenth of 80-90mm; It is 200-600kg/m that described heat insulating material 2 preferably adopts density rating 3light heat insulation material, its dried intensity is greater than 0.25MPa, significant improve floor load-bearing object in, reduced greatly the deadweight of heat insulating material 2; Described anticracking grout 3 preferably adopts the pea gravel concreten of label more than C15, when building, should add polypropylene fibre, can effectively improve the stretching resistance of anticracking grout 3 in effective anticracking.
Spacing between described former bamboo tower plate-girder 1 Central Plains bamboo is 1-4cm.
The thickness of described heat insulating material 2 is 80-90mm.
The thickness of described anticracking grout 3 is 5-10mm.
Embodiment 2
Referring to Fig. 3-4, as the improvement to embodiment 1, preferably, on described former bamboo tower plate-girder 1, be coated with one deck back-up coat 4, this back-up coat 4 is comprised of the bamboo strip layer 41 being evenly arranged on former bamboo tower plate-girder 1, every independently bamboo cane 41 by self-tapping screw and former bamboo, be connected and fixed, on described back-up coat 4, be coated with one layer of heat preservation material 2, on this heat insulating material 2, be coated with one deck anticracking grout 3; Spacing between wherein said former bamboo tower plate-girder 1 Central Plains bamboo is 2-6cm.
In the present embodiment, owing to having increased back-up coat 4 at former bamboo tower plate-girder 1, make it relaxing between former bamboo tower plate-girder 1 Central Plains bamboo in spacing, further improve the pulling force of floor entirety, improved overall anti-seismic performance.
Embodiment 3
Referring to Fig. 5-6, as the improvement to embodiment 1 and embodiment 2, preferably, described former bamboo tower plate-girder 1 entirety is comprised of the two-layer former bamboo being arranged side by side, between this two-layer former bamboo, be provided with back-up coat 4, described back-up coat 4 by be evenly arranged between former bamboo bamboo cane 41 form, every independently bamboo cane 41 by self-tapping screw and former bamboo, be connected and fixed, between two neighbouring former bamboos, be connected with connector 5.
Described connector 5 comprises the annular catch 51 that fits in former bamboo external surface, the middle part of this annular catch 51 offers screw, in this screw, be provided with the shank of bolt 52 coordinating with its grafting, the other end of described shank of bolt 52 is through the former bamboo in upper strata, and the former bamboo of bamboo cane 41 and lower floor is spun and is fixed into one by annular catch 51 and bolt 53; Spacing in wherein said former bamboo tower plate-girder 1 between every layer of former bamboo is 2-9cm.
In the present embodiment owing to adopting double-deck former bamboo design, and between be provided with back-up coat 4, the horizontal and vertical pulling force of entirety is higher, bearing capacity is also corresponding higher, therefore heat insulating material 2 preferable range that are cast on former bamboo tower plate-girder 1 can be between 80-150mm, thereby further improve the shearing resistance of floor and overall heat-insulating property, the safety of entirety is higher.
Because former bamboo deformability is strong, Gu such floor all plays control action with amount of deflection.Through test, record the payload values when floor reaches permission amount of deflection limit value (with reference to wooden construction standard).All meet regulation and stipulation.Concrete outcome is as shown in the table:
Floor type Sample dimensions Heat insulating material is thick Former bamboo rule used cun (KN/m 2)
Embodiment 1 2000×700 80+10 90±5mm 9.1
Embodiment 2 2000×700 80+10 90±5mm 11.3
Embodiment 3 2000×700 80+10 70±5mm 18.7
